Output 4e31a638606bec968d9eefe42df329c6ec695ab816a8979ceaff0351fff068de:30

value
172860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ff7592ef2cacd4699de7f7ae605e88b0a1ec20b OP_EQUAL
address
37XEohHDXHGkDAmXyTcE3HwBYN1dU32Kei
transaction
4e31a638606bec968d9eefe42df329c6ec695ab816a8979ceaff0351fff068de
spent
true